First-Class Roofing Work by a Go-To roofer in chesterfield

How to Determine Usual Roofing Issues and Their SolutionsWhen it pertains to maintaining your roofing, identifying common issues early can conserve you money and time. You could discover indications like water discolorations, missing roof shingles, or perhaps moss development. Each of these concerns has details causes and services that you should r

read more


Emergency roof repair Calgary residents count on for fast results

Roofing Contractor Calgary, AlbertaLocate Affordable Roof Covering Providers That Meet Your Budget and NeedsBrowsing the complicated world of roof covering solutions can be a difficult job, especially with a tight budget plan. With a plethora of factors to take into consideration, from the professional's online reputation to the high quality of pro

read more